Up to £12.82 Per Hour Doncaster, YorkshireFull-Time This is a temporary role for a period of 9 months
Do you have the commitment and positive values to make a difference to the lives of people living in Doncaster, South Yorkshire?
We are looking for a caring, dynamic and highly motivated person to join the team as a Support Coordinator in our Doncaster Supported Living Services. This is an exciting opportunity to be part of our well-established services, which supports individuals with learning disabilities.
You must have skills in positive communication and engagement and will be able to demonstrate unconditional regard for the people we support. You will also have skills in the assessment of needs and proactive risk management, so that support planning for individuals demonstrates an active and fulfilling life with an emphasis on a ‘can do' approach.
Support Coordinator Duties:
- Provide outcome focused support to enable clients to lead fulfilling and valued lives, maintain their tenancies, participate in their local community and much more
- Effectively meet the needs of our clients and to take additional responsibilities such as rota management, induction of staff and staff supervision
- Work in a flexible manner which may including working evenings and weekends and sleep in's
- Participate in our local On Call
- Administering medication
As well as providing direct support, the Support Coordinator role also requires some off rota time, which has been developed to support the management of service delivery. This is an opportunity for personal and career development as we offer good conditions of service and a supportive, hands-on management culture.
It is essential to have a clean, up to date driving license and access to a vehicle for this role, as the role requires travelling around the Doncaster area.
